2017 Jeep Rubicon JKU (Granite Crystal) - I intend to use this jeep primarily for overland and camping trips with my friends. Have taken a couple of trips into Utah - Moab and the Dixie National Forest. Planning to take longer trips in 2022 when I retire. Up to Canada and Alaska. This Jeep is definitely not a mall crawler and sees some tough off-road trails from time to time. Not a rock crawler but not afraid to tackle some challenging trails. I live in Desert Hills Arizona near Cave Creek and do some camping up on the Rim and the White Mountains. I bring along a couple of friends of mine that have 4Runners so I can practice doing recovery for them when they cannot keep up with my jeep. I do most of the work on the jeep myself except for some of the special work that requires welding or when I had the gears changed. Always something to work on when you own a Jeep.
Modifications
Drivetrain
Rubicon Dana 44 Axles with front and rear trusses. C-Gussets, Revolution 4:88 gears, Revolution Chrome-Moly Axles front and rear. Adams extreme 1350 rear drive shaft. 1410 front drive shaft. PowerStop Big Brake Kit.
Interior
Hushmat tub, Doors and roof completely, Bedrug Headliners with Hushmat sound mat. Dual ARB Compressor under drivers seat, ham radio under the passenger seat, Midland GMRS radio up front, 8 switch control panel, Two KC cyclones on the sound bar. Goose Gear 100% delete sleeping platform.
Exterior
Smitybilt front and rear bumpers, Smitybilt 9500 winch, Teraflex HD rear tire carrier, HD hinge kit and Accessory Bracket for Ham and GMRS antennas and Rotopacks. Front Runner Slimline II roof Rack with High Lift Jack mount and shovel mount
Audio
Factory head unit with Alpine 75 Watt AMP, Audio Control LC71 and Alpine series R speakers throughout. Completely sound deadened enclosures. Audio Control LC7i and Alpine amp under the passenger seat.
Lighting
240 AM alternator with a big three cable upgrade. Odyssey 34R-PC 1500 T battery. LED head lights, 6 - three inch LED cube lights - four at the based of the windshield and two on the front bumper. 20in Rough Country light bar with amber DRL. LED Tail lights and back up lights. Rock Lights, under hood cyclones
Exhaust
Stock
Suspension
EVO 3" Plus Ride Springs, Bilstein Shocks, Teraflex Alpine adjustable control arms. StearSmarts everything upfront. Synergy steering box sector shaft brace and trackbar brace.
Wheel and Tire
35" Nitto Ridge Grapplers on Fuel Beast wheels
